What are some common challenges a CVS Manager faces when leading a pharmacy team?

As a CVS Manager, one of the primary challenges is balancing operational efficiency with exceptional customer service in a fast-paced retail pharmacy environment. Managers must ensure their team meets strict compliance and safety standards, handle scheduling complexities, and address staffing shortages, all while maintaining high morale and performance. Additionally, they often navigate evolving healthcare regulations and technology updates, requiring ongoing training and adaptability. Effective communication and leadership skills are key to overcoming these challenges and fostering a collaborative team atmosphere.

What are CVS Managers?

CVS Managers, also known as Store Managers at CVS Pharmacy locations, are responsible for overseeing the daily operations of a CVS store. They manage staff, ensure excellent customer service, maintain inventory, and work to achieve sales goals. CVS Managers also handle hiring and training employees, addressing customer concerns, and ensuring compliance with company policies and procedures. Their role is vital for ensuring the store runs smoothly and efficiently while meeting company standards.

Job Summary:

Provides procedural support to physicians including hemodynamic, electrophysiologic monitoring, sterile technique, and radiologic support; maintains a well-stocked and clean work environment.

Job Responsibilities:

-Understands general use of radiologic and monitoring equipment.

-Performs departmental functions within Epic; communicates with technical coordinator, material coordinator, or CVT III's to maintain equipment and supply.

-Operates specialized equipment according to protocols.

-Assists physician in using specialized equipment during procedures (i.e. IVUS, pressure wire, Possess, IABP, Bloom stimulator, EPT and Medtronic RF sources, etc.).

-Attends vendor in-services to learn new equipment.

-Supports new technologies.

-Performs patient care appropriate to the patient population.

-Assists in transporting patients to and from the department.

-Performs appropriate patient care in a sterile environment under the guidance of the physician and RN.

-Assists in other areas of cardiology if needed as directed by the CVS Manager.

-Supports unit/hospital goals through PI and educational activities.

-Attends mandatory in-services and meets department educational standards; accurately completes any variance reports; modifies behaviors or performance to comply with care standards and meets department requirements.
